Presented by The Underground Cinema, Sound & Vision: A Season of Films About Music is a season of music-oriented films featuring legendary live shows, iconic documentaries and cult classics, including Modern Films titles Keyboard Fantasies, Ryuichi Sakamoto: Coda and Sisters with Transistors.
Keyboard Fantasies
Directed by Posy Dixon, 2019
Emerging from years in isolation to an enraptured crowd, transgender, septuagenarian musical genius Beverly Glenn-Copeland finally finds his place in the world. Keyboard Fantasies tells the tale of this mystical musician as he embarks on his first international tour at the age of 74.

Sisters with Transistors
Directed by Lisa Rovner, 2020
The story of electronic music’s female pioneers, including Delia Darbyshire, Laurie Anderson and Suzanne Ciani – composers who embraced machines and their liberating technologies.

Ryuichi Sakamoto: Coda
Directed by Stephen Nomura Schible, 2017
An intimate documentary chronicling the legendary composer’s life, focusing on his creation of the album async following a cancer diagnosis, his activism against nuclear power, and his career spanning four decades.
